Yes, the color of the truck in the top photo is "creme" and it's my old '83 truck. The buyer I sold it to converted it to round headlights, added the stripes and had the bed sand blasted and coated. Can't recall the color code, but it was NOT A48. Creme is a decent color, but very bland IMHO--more yellowish than beige/tan. The paint was the original paint, just buffed out.
